Industrial zone of the city of Sombor is situated on the south east outskirts of the city itself. The total area covers around 500 ha.

Distance to other locations:

             - Belgrade 185 km

            - Nikola Tesla Airport 180 km

            - highway 60 km

            - the nearest border crossing to Croatia 25 km and Hungary 28 km

            - the Danube River 20 km

 

 

 

Traffic

Access routes:

- Major road M-18

- South III, a road connected to the regional road R-17.1

- Access road, leading to the Edible Oil Factory from the regional road R-17.1 from Novi Sad and Subotica 

The industrial zone is located in close proximity to the Great Bačka Canal, about 600 m by air, and about 5 km from a military airport with a potential to be transformed into a commercial airport.   

The industrial zone is connected to the major road M-18, with two intersections where left turn allows access to the major route. The industrial zone is intersected by the projected bypass (there is an internal traffic route currently in the corridor, marked in the Block 102, 103 Regulation Plan as route S-4).

 

Available Utility Infrastructure

 

The industrial zone is supplied with primary gas line, water, sewage, partially built road network, partially resolved stormwater drainage with a closed drain system and with land reclamation canals running through the Industrial Zone.    

Electrical Installations - The Industrial zone is supplied from a 20kV line ‘Borovo and 20kV line ‘Selenča 3’ from TS 110/20 kV ‘Sombor 1’. There is a 400 MW transformer station in Sombor territory indicating the possibility to facilitate higher electricity consumption. Currently unused available electric power capacity in the Industrial zone amounts to around 4 MW.   

Water Supply - The Industrial zone is supplied with water from a factory ‘Jaroš’ with 200 l/s capacity. From the factory, the water is distributed to the Industrial zone by 500 and 300 mm water mains. There are also 3 deep wells with capacity of 30 lit/s which satisfy the needs for technical water. The pipeline is stretched to distribute water to existing as well as to known future consumers.   

Sewerage System - The sewerage system is separate. 

Waste water is collected through pipelines and transported to waste water treatment facility (with capacity of 80 000 citizens). There are 800 and 600 mm water mains connecting the Industrial zone with the waste water treatment facility. The pipeline is stretched to existing and known future users. 

Stormwater is drained through open canals and pipelines into land reclamation canals within the Industrial zone and, from there, into the Great Bačka Canal.   

Investors have the obligation to ensure stormwater drainage into the public drainage network class 2A.

Gas Line - A GMRS has been installed within the Industrial zone. The primary network consists of steel pipes and the gas is delivered through the distribution network consisting of polyethylene pipes.  

TT Installations - The location is supplied with a main optical TT cable, as well as with a telephone network for existing subscribers.

Internet - Internet access in the Industrial zone can be provided via ADSL service offered by ‘Telekom Srbija’.
